End a disciplinary letter with the next steps or the expected correction for the issues. Be clear on what will happen if the employee doesn't correct the issue. Include a spot at the bottom for the manager's and employee's signatures.
A clear and concise employee written warning states and numbers each infraction and includes: The incident date(s) The name of the person's supervisor. The name of the person's HR representative. Person's name. Person's job title. A clear account of the verbal warnings given. The conduct they need to change.

State why you are writing to the employee. State how long you'll place the warning on their file, and if you intend to disregard it after a certain amount of time. Detail the nature of the offence, incident, or behaviour. Note how you expect the employee to improve (you may add a timescale of expected improvement).
Things to Consider While Writing a Warning Letter to Employees Mention the date of warning. Write the company name with the name of the person issuing the letter. Include the subject. Write the name of the employees. Mention the details of the violation.
